The Big Play

Featuring a new work by Melbourne composer Katy Abbott, this activity is for all musicians. Just bring your instrument and join the massed orchestra to workshop a piece with the composer and guest conductors. Rehearse beforehand using In the Chair software or hardcopy of your part. This activity is available for on-line delegates.

Composer_Connecting_Community Concert

Be the first to hear the World Premiere of works commissioned by Orchestras Australia that will be presented by the composers; Katy Abbott and Matthew Hindson. The concert also includes a state premiere of Graham Howard’s flute concerto “The Nude” and the presentation of the 2006 National Orchestral Awards. This activity is available for on-line delegates.
